How Scams Like Ronitrade.com Operate

Scams in the cryptocurrency space often follow a similar pattern:

  1. They promise unusually high returns or free money: This is the hook to attract victims.
  2. They require an investment: Once you’ve taken the bait, they’ll ask for a deposit or some form of investment.
  3. They disappear with your money: After you’ve invested, the scammer will find a way to disappear with your funds, leaving you with nothing.

Protecting Yourself from Scams Like Ronitrade.com

To avoid falling victim to scams like Ronitrade.com, it’s essential to be vigilant and cautious. Here are some tips:

  • Research thoroughly: Before investing in any platform, research it thoroughly. Look for independent reviews, check their social media presence, and try to find information about the company behind the platform.
  • Be wary of unsolicited offers: If an offer seems too good to be true, it probably is. Be cautious of unsolicited emails, messages, or ads promising easy money.
  • Use secure networks: When investing or trading cryptocurrency, always use a secure, private network. Public Wi-Fi can be easily hacked, putting your investments at risk.
